About the Item

Stunning French Art Deco Cubist Bronze Vase with Dinanderie Patina This exquisite French Art Deco vase is a masterful example of Cubist design, crafted from fine bronze and featuring the renowned Dinanderie patina technique. The vase showcases an elegant cylindrical shape with a subtly flared rim, adorned with a striking geometric pattern that reflects the bold, modern aesthetics of the 1920s and 1930s Art Deco movement. The meticulous craftsmanship is evident in the intricate engraving and patination, with golden, metallic tones that give the vase a sophisticated, timeless appeal. This unique piece combines artistic innovation with traditional metalworking, making it an exceptional decorative object for discerning collectors and interior enthusiasts. A true statement piece, this rare bronze vase captures the essence of French Art Deco design and will elevate any luxury setting.
